A reviewer has raised concerns about the quality of AI training datasets, particularly those labeled by individuals lacking subject-matter expertise. The reviewer noted that datasets for specific fields, such as behavioral psychology, are being classified by individuals with general "data scientist" titles but no relevant specialized knowledge. This practice introduces a significant risk of "garbage in, garbage out" (GIGO) in AI research, with implications for the validity of published papers and the review process within academia. AI
